Understanding Office Pods
Office pods are standalone, modular structures designed to provide a quiet, private space within an open office environment. They come in various sizes and designs, including small pods for individual use and larger ones that can accommodate small teams. These pods often feature soundproofing, ergonomic furniture, and sometimes even technological amenities like video conferencing equipment. The primary purpose of office pods is to offer employees a respite from the bustling office atmosphere, enabling them to focus, collaborate, or simply take a break in a dedicated space.
Reducing Stress and Enhancing Focus
One of the most significant benefits of office pods is their ability to reduce stress and enhance focus. Open-plan offices, while promoting collaboration, can also be a source of constant noise and distractions. This can lead to increased stress levels and decreased productivity. Office pods provide a quiet retreat where employees can escape the din of the main office. This seclusion is particularly beneficial for tasks requiring deep concentration or for employees needing a moment of calm to recharge.
Studies have shown that noise levels in open offices can negatively impact employee well-being. By incorporating office pods, companies can mitigate these effects. The pods offer a sanctuary from interruptions, allowing employees to immerse themselves in their work without the usual distractions. This improvement in focus not only helps in achieving higher quality work but also contributes to overall job satisfaction and mental health.
Supporting Mental Health and Well-Being
Mental health is a crucial component of overall wellness, and office pods play a role in supporting it. Having access to a private space where employees can take a break, manage stress, or even meditate helps create a healthier work environment. Many office pods are designed with features that promote relaxation, such as comfortable seating, calming colors, and sometimes even elements like plants or soft lighting.
Incorporating office pods into wellness programs also demonstrates a company’s commitment to employee well-being. It signals to employees that their mental health is valued, which can improve morale and foster a positive workplace culture. When employees feel supported in their mental health needs, they are more likely to be engaged and committed to their work.
